Spring: Embracing Renewal
Spring is a season of rebirth and renewal, and your interior design ought to mirror this sense of freshness. Opt for light and ethereal materials like sheer curtains that enable ample sunlight to brighten up the space. Soft pastel colors reminiscent of mint green, pale pink, and sky blue can infuse the room with the spirit of spring. Consider layering the sheer curtains with heavier drapes in complementary hues to maintain privateness while still enjoying the inflow of natural light.
Summer: Maximizing Natural Light
Summer invites the sunshine into our houses, and your interior design should capitalize on this. Choose shade curtains in lighter tones to create an open and breezy atmosphere. Linen or cotton curtains can provide a chic yet relaxed look. For a contact of vibrancy, experiment with patterns inspired by nature, reminiscent of floral prints or ocean-inspired motifs. By allowing sunlight to pour in during the longer summer days, you possibly can create an inviting and warm environment.
Autumn: Cozying Up
Because the leaves change colour and the air turns crisp, it’s time to transition your interior design to match the coziness of autumn. Consider switching to heavier materials like velvet or thicker cotton curtains in warm, earthy tones such as rust, deep orange, or olive green. These shades can evoke the sensation of autumn foliage and convey a way of warmth to your space. Layering curtains with totally different textures can add depth and a tactile element to the room, making it an ideal place to curve up with a book or a cup of hot cider.
Winter: Embracing Comfort
When winter arrives, your interior design ought to concentrate on creating a comfortable and comfortable retreat from the cold. Opt for curtains in rich, deep colors like burgundy, navy, or charcoal gray. Heavier materials like wool or suede can provide insulation towards the cold drafts, while additionally adding a touch of luxury. Consider adding blackout curtains to keep out the longer nights, creating a comfy cocoon that’s perfect for relaxation and reflection.
